
In a powerful show of grassroots strength and political momentum, APC Chairmanship Candidate for Ejigbo LCDA, Aare Taoheed Adebayo Taiwo (TAT), led his campaign team into Oke-Afa Ward, where he met with the Coalition of Community Development Associations (CDAs) to unveil his development-focused agenda.
Flanked by his Vice Chairmanship running mate, Councilorship Candidate of Oke Afa Ward, Hon. Bisi Muritala and all 5 other APC Councillorship candidates, TAT reeled out his Seven-Point Manifesto before a hall filled with key stakeholders, promising inclusive governance, people-centric service delivery, and renewed attention to community infrastructure.

The event was not just political—it was strategic. CDAs expressed renewed trust in TAT’s candidacy, affirming their readiness to support all APC candidates in the July 12 elections.
TAT, in his remarks, assured the gathering that their support would translate to visible and measurable development once the mandate is secured.
